loquacious
Definitions
[lə(ʊ)ˈkweɪʃəs], (Adjective)
Definitions:
- tending to talk a great deal; talkative
(e.g: never loquacious, Sarah was now totally lost for words)
Phrases:
Origin
:
mid 17th century: from Latin loquax, loquac- (from loqui ‘talk’) + -ious
